ζυμόω
ζυμόω, -ῶ(< ζύμη), [in LXX for חָמֵץ, Ex 12:34, 39, Le 6:17(10) 23:17, Ho 7:4*;]to leaven: Mt 13:33, Lk 13:21, I Co 5:6, Ga 5:9.†
A Manual Greek Lexicon of the New Testament, G. Abbott-Smith, 1922.
